KUJUNTI.ID MINISH3LL
Path : /var/www/html/moneyexchange/routes/
(S)h3ll Cr3at0r :
F!le Upl0ad :

B-Con CMD Config cPanel C-Rdp D-Log Info Jump Mass Ransom Symlink vHost Zone-H

Current File : /var/www/html/moneyexchange/routes/web.php


<?php

use Illuminate\Support\Facades\Route;

/*
|--------------------------------------------------------------------------
| Web Routes
|--------------------------------------------------------------------------
|
| Here is where you can register web routes for your application. These
| routes are loaded by the RouteServiceProvider within a group which
| contains the "web" middleware group. Now create something great!
|
*/
Route::get('/lang/{locale}', function ($locale) {
    if (! in_array($locale, ['en', 'th','kh'])) {
        abort(400);
    } 
    // App::setLocale($locale);    
    \Session::put('language', $locale);
   	return redirect()->back(); 
});
Route::resources([
	'settings' => 'App\Http\Controllers\SettingController',
	'users' => 'App\Http\Controllers\UserController',
	'banks' => 'App\Http\Controllers\BankController',
	'currencies' => 'App\Http\Controllers\CurrencyController',	
	'bank-accounts' => 'App\Http\Controllers\BankAccountController',
    'bank-accounts' => 'App\Http\Controllers\BankAccountController',
	'transactions' => 'App\Http\Controllers\TransactionController',    
    'transfers' => 'App\Http\Controllers\TransferController',    
    'money-exchange-lists' => 'App\Http\Controllers\MoneyExchangeListController',
    'bank-account-transaction-types' => 'App\Http\Controllers\BankAccountTransactionTypeController',    
]);

Auth::routes();
Route::get('/money-exchange-list/rate/create/{moneyExchangeListId}', [App\Http\Controllers\MoneyExchangeListController::class, 'rateCreate'])->name('rate-create');
Route::get('/exchange-invoice/{id?}', [App\Http\Controllers\ExchangeController::class, 'invoice'])->name('exchange-invoice');
Route::get('/bank-account-transactions', [App\Http\Controllers\BankAccountTransactionController::class, 'index'])->name('bank-account-transactions.index');
Route::get('/bank-account-transactions/download', [App\Http\Controllers\BankAccountTransactionController::class, 'download'])->name('bank-account-transactions.download');


Route::get('/transfer-in', [App\Http\Controllers\TransferController::class, 'transferIn'])->name('transfer-in');
Route::get('/transfer-out', [App\Http\Controllers\TransferController::class, 'transferOut'])->name('transfer-out');
Route::get('/retransfer-in', [App\Http\Controllers\TransferController::class, 'reTransferIn'])->name('retransfer-in');
Route::get('/retransfer-out', [App\Http\Controllers\TransferController::class, 'reTransferOut'])->name('retransfer-out');

Route::get('/transfer-report', [App\Http\Controllers\TransferController::class, 'transferReport'])->name('transfers.transfer-report');
Route::get('/retransfer-report', [App\Http\Controllers\TransferController::class, 'reTransferInReport'])->name('transfers.retransfer-report');

Route::get('/transfer-in-transactions', [App\Http\Controllers\TransferController::class, 'transferInTransaction'])->name('transfers.transfer-in-transactions');
Route::get('/transfer-out-transactions', [App\Http\Controllers\TransferController::class, 'transferOutTransaction'])->name('transfers.transfer-out-transactions');
Route::get('/retransfer-in-transactions', [App\Http\Controllers\TransferController::class, 'reTransferInTransaction'])->name('transfers.retransfer-in-transactions');
Route::get('/retransfer-out-transactions', [App\Http\Controllers\TransferController::class, 'reTransferOutTransaction'])->name('transfers.retransfer-out-transactions');


Route::get('/bank-account/{id}/deposit-withdraw', [App\Http\Controllers\BankAccountController::class, 'bankAccountDepositWithdraw'])->name('bank-accounts.deposit-withdraw.create');

Route::get('/exchange-money/create/{transacton_id?}', [App\Http\Controllers\ExchangeController::class, 'create'])->name('exchange-money.create');
Route::get('/profit-report', [App\Http\Controllers\ExchangeController::class, 'profitReport'])->name('profit-report');
Route::post('/exchange-money/store', [App\Http\Controllers\ExchangeController::class, 'store'])->name('exchange-money.store');
Route::get('/transactions', [App\Http\Controllers\ExchangeController::class, 'transaction'])->name('transactions');
Route::get('/transaction/download', [App\Http\Controllers\ExchangeController::class, 'transactionDownload'])->name('transactions.download');
Route::get('/transaction/download1', [App\Http\Controllers\ExchangeController::class, 'transactionDownload1'])->name('transactions.download1');
Route::get('/money-exchange-report', [App\Http\Controllers\ExchangeController::class, 'report'])->name('money-exchange-report');
Route::post('/bank-account/{id}/deposit-withdraw/store', [App\Http\Controllers\BankAccountController::class, 'bankAccountDepositWithdrawStore'])->name('bank-accounts.deposit-withdraw.store');

Route::post('/money-exchange-list/rate/store/{moneyExchangeListId}', [App\Http\Controllers\MoneyExchangeListController::class, 'rateStore'])->name('money-exchange-list-rates.store');
Route::get('/money-exchange-list/rate/history/{moneyExchangeListId}', [App\Http\Controllers\MoneyExchangeListController::class, 'rateHistory'])->name('money-exchange-rate.history');

Route::get('/', [App\Http\Controllers\HomeController::class, 'index'])->name('home');
Auth::routes([
    'register' => false,
    'verify' => false,

    'reset' => false,
    'confirm' => false
]);

© KUJUNTI.ID